Set backs....

Friday, Evynn was able to tolerate a CT scan. In order for Evynn to safely go the CT she had to have a cardiovascular surgeon go with her and hold her chest strings up until the very moment the scanner was on. She had to stay stable for 1minute unsuspended. It was quite a production.
The team was hoping that using a stent in a heart catheter procedure would correct the problem with her IVC. Unfortunately, Evynn's suregon feels the stent would not work as a long term solution. So instead tomorrow Evynn will be discussed at surgical conference and they will decide when she should go back to the O.R. for another open heart surgery. The debate is balancing minimizing the risk of infection by doing it sooner vs giving her body more time to recover from the massive trauma of having a transplant. The CT also showed more clots have formed in her jugular viens, which could explain the swings in blood pressure.
For now Evynn remains chest suspend, vented and fully sedated. Her journey is going to be much longer before she is safe and home.
